  • Under the new General Education (GE) Curriculum, implemented in AY2015/16, GE modules are divided into 5 pillars, namely:
  1. Human Cultures
  2. Singapore Studies
  3. Thinking and Expression
  4. Quantitative Reasoning (GER1000 is the only module offered under this pillar)
  5. Asking Questions (GEQ1000 is the only module offered under this pillar)

The ModReg Add/Swap round has ended. For those who have yet to secure a slot,  or wish to change your slot,  you may:


Email to GEQ: askq@nus.edu.sg, GER: qradmin@nus.edu.sg

  • Use your NUS email account
  • State your Student Number (Axxxxxxxx)
  • Rank five tutorial groups and timeslots in order of preference. 
  • Provide the reason if you wish to change your slot
  • The appeals will be processed on a first-come-first-serve basis.
  • Please send us a clear screenshot of your timetable


Things to Note:

  • Provide supporting documents such as medical appointments, external class or work commitments, to support your request
  • Change of slots may be done only for valid reasons.   Some examples of reasons that are not accepted are:- to be in the same class as a friend, travelling time, back-to-back- lessons (as classes end 30mins earlier to cater for travelling time between venues).

 

Students who do not have a tutorial slot by the end of Week 2, will be pre-allocated a slot from what is available and on a random basis.


General Notes

  • For GEQ and GER modules, there are no physical lectures.

  • You will attend a 2-hour tutorial, once every two weeks (Odd or Even)

                - ODD classes starts in Week 3 (28 January 2020 onwards)

                - EVEN classes start in Week 4 (3 Feb 2020 onwards)
